§ 830. Detail of troops to Yosemite National Park

The Secretary of the Army upon the request of the Secretary of the Interior shall make the necessary detail of troops to prevent trespassers or intruders from entering the Yosemite National Park, in California, for the purpose of destroying the game or objects of curiosity therein, or for any other purpose prohibited by law or regulation for the government of said park, and to remove such persons from said park if found therein.

§ 851. Location; continuance as park; boundaries

Zion National Park, situated in the State of Utah, established as a national monument July 31, 1909 and as a national park November 19, 1919, shall continue as a national park embracing the following described areas:

§ 891. Arches National Monument, Utah; continuance as national monument

The Arches National Monument situated in the county of Grand, State of Utah, established April 12, 1929, by presidential proclamation, shall continue as a national monument as limited by boundaries established or changed comformably to law.

§ 892. Aztec Ruins National Monument, New Mexico; continuance as national monument

The Aztec Ruins National Monument situated in the county of San Juan, State of New Mexico, established January 24, 1923, by presidential proclamation, shall continue as a national monument as limited by boundaries established or changed conformably to law.

§ 893. Badlands National Monument, South Dakota

(a) Location; continuance as national monument

The Badlands National Monument, situated in the State of South Dakota, established January 25, 1939, shall continue as a national monument as limited by boundaries established or changed conformably to law.
